Understanding Micro Cable Types: USB-A, Micro USB, and USB-C

When choosing a micro cable, understanding the types available is key. USB-A is the standard connector. It's widely used for charging and data transfer. However, it lacks certain features that newer cables offer. Many devices now require more advanced connections.

Micro USB is a common option, found in older smartphones and gadgets. It works well for charging and data transfer. Despite its convenience, micro USB has limitations. The connector is fragile and can wear out over time. This can lead to connectivity issues.

On the other hand, USB-C is gaining popularity quickly. It offers a reversible design, making it user-friendly. USB-C supports faster charging and higher data transfer rates. However, compatibility can be a concern. Not all devices support USB-C yet.

When selecting a cable, consider your devices’ requirements. Each type has strengths and weaknesses, making careful selection crucial.

Key Specifications to Consider: Length, Data Speed, and Power Rating

Choosing the right micro cable can significantly impact your device’s performance. Key specifications to focus on include length, data speed, and power rating.

Length is essential. A cable that is too long can lead to signal loss. A short cable might limit your device's usability. Select a length that facilitates your specific needs. A 3-foot cable works well for close connections, while a 10-foot option offers flexibility in larger spaces.

Data speed matters for transferring files. USB 2.0 supports up to 480 Mbps. Meanwhile, USB 3.0 can reach 5 Gbps. For tasks like video streaming or large file transfers, prioritize a cable with higher data rates.

Power rating is crucial, especially for charging devices. Standard charging cables provide 2.1A, while fast chargers can go beyond that. Ensure your chosen micro cable meets your power needs. Using an inadequate cable may result in slower charging times.

Durability Factors: Material and Build Quality of Micro Cables

When choosing a micro cable, durability is essential. The material used significantly influences the cable's lifespan. Look for cables with reinforced connectors. These typically endure frequent plugging and unplugging better than standard ones. Additionally, braided nylon or PVC sheaths offer improved resistance against wear and tear. They help to prevent fraying and damage from bending, which is a common issue.

The build quality cannot be overlooked. Poorly made cables may break easily, leading to frustration. Inspect the strain relief at both ends of the cable. This part supports the connection and prevents stress during use. Ensure it feels sturdy and well-attached. Choosing cables that have been rigorously tested can provide peace of mind. However, even with a reliable cable, be mindful of how you use it. Excessive bending or pulling can still cause damage over time. The Ultimate Guide to Choosing the Right Balanced Microphone Cable: Benefits of 2X0.3MM2 Braid PVC

When it comes to selecting the right balanced microphone cable, understanding the specifications and benefits of cable construction is crucial. A well-constructed cable, such as one featuring a 2X0.3MM2 (22AWG) thick conductor, ensures enhanced audio signal transmission with lower capacitance. This is particularly important in professional audio environments where clarity and fidelity are paramount. Studies have shown that lower capacitance cables can significantly reduce the loss of high-frequency signals, leading to clearer sound reproduction.

The importance of shielding cannot be overstated, especially in environments susceptible to electromagnetic interference (EMI). A dual shielded design utilizing 100% aluminum foil and 90% OFC (Oxygen-Free Copper) braid not only protects the cable from external noise but also helps maintain the integrity of the audio signal. According to industry reports, effective shielding can improve signal quality and reduce the likelihood of interference from other electronic devices. This additional layer of protection is essential for performers and audio technicians who rely on consistent and reliable sound quality.

Moreover, twisted conductor pairs further enhance performance by reducing crosstalk and maintaining a balanced impedance. This configuration is supported by research indicating that twisted-pair cables exhibit better noise rejection capabilities, making them a preferred choice for professional audio applications. By choosing a balanced microphone cable with these specific features, audio professionals can ensure that they achieve optimal sound quality in their recordings and live performances.
